Analysis
In 2024, gdp per capita in international and market dollars in Bermuda stood at 116,514 constant 2015 US$.
That represents a change of up 2.0% on the previous year and up 12.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, gdp per capita in international and market dollars in Bermuda peaked at 132,595 constant 2015 US$ in 2007 and was at its lowest, 39,906 constant 2015 US$, in 1960.
Bermuda ranks 2nd of 209 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 65 years of available data.

About this data
Average economic output per person in a country or region per year. This data is adjusted by inflation but _does not_ account for differences in living costs between countries.
